The active coenzyme form, pyridoxal 5'-phosphate (P5P), is ready for immediate use without requiring conversion by the liver. Unlike pyridoxine hydrochloride (HCl), which must be converted, P5P can support metabolic processes as soon as it enters your system. Individuals with liver stress, genetic variations, or certain health conditions may find the active form more efficient for absorption.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003ch2\u003eHow to Choose a Vitamin B6 Supplement\u003c\/h2\u003e\u003cp\u003eWhen selecting a vitamin B6 supplement, consider the form: pyridoxal phosphate (P5P) versus pyridoxine HCl. It must be converted by the liver into P5P before the body can use it. This conversion can be inefficient in some people, especially those with liver issues or certain genetic variations. Pyridoxal phosphate bypasses this step, providing immediate bioavailability. For individuals seeking maximum absorption and efficacy, P5P is often the preferred choice. The tolerable upper intake level for B6 is 100 mg per day for adults; prolonged intake above this level may lead to nerve toxicity. Always read the label and follow directions for use.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003ch2\u003ePotential Side Effects \u0026amp; Safety Considerations\u003c\/h2\u003e\u003cp\u003eVitamin B6 from food and standard supplements is generally safe. However, high doses (typically above 200 mg per day for extended periods) can cause peripheral neuropathy, characterised by tingling or numbness in the hands and feet. This condition is usually reversible when the dosage is reduced. If you are currently taking medications such as levodopa for Parkinson's disease, or certain antibiotics and anticonvulsants, consult your healthcare provider before adding a B6 supplement.
